Do your research!!
This is a huge park and the activities, shows, restaurants, etc are a good distance apart. The distance isn’t crazy long but long enough that if you don’t plan well it’s going to eat up a lot of your time.
TIPS:
– google the Xcaret map b4 your trip and get familiar with it. Highlight your interest and must-dos so that you have an idea of where you want to start and how to get from point A to point B.
– When you arrive don’t stop at the gift shop. Buy the Xcaret Plus and go straight to point 7 (the Xcaret Plus lockers/dressing rooms). Get your lockers and start from here.
– Don’t get into the river first. It seems that a lot of people go from the lockers to the river 1st making it crowded. We got into the river later in the day and for the most part, had the river to ourselves. We all got the fins, not mandatory but we found them helpful.
– There is more than 1 river to swim through. Make sure you plan your time well enough if you want to check out all 3; the Blue River, the Mayan River, and the Manatee River.
– Extra $$ for activities like Stingrays encounter, Sharks, Sea Trek, Adrenalina. Snorkeling tour. Reservations are needed and tickets can be bought online or at the park. We did the kids encounter with stingrays and sea trek, both were pretty cool and would recommend. The helmet for the sea trek is heavy, but not undouble.
– Make time to visit the Mayan Village and check out those workshops. Worth it!!!
– The best place to get our included buffet with the Plus admission: La Caleta behind the sea trek and next to the lagoon area. Live music and the food was pretty good for a buffet.
– DON’T MISS the México Espectacular show. IF you can splurge on the dinner, do it. We thought it was well worth it!! The show alone was fantastic!! We were all super impressed with the quality, the visual effects, the music, the artistic touch to such an awesome history. Viva Mexico!!
Julie B –
This bad review is just for ADRENALINA jet boat which was horrible experience. I love extreme fun and It looks like it is going to go fast and do spins, which they do a little but what they really like to do is immersion where the dunk the front of the boat and you a ton of water hard in the face. It is very similar to being in the ocean and getting hit hard by a massive wave and then being stuck under water. Also not enjoyable having salt water run out your nose. And they do it over and over again many times (I think they did it 10 times) which sucks! One time my head got forced to the side by the power of the wave and all that water rushed hard into my ear which was painful for awhile after that experience. When I asked them to stop, they kept doing it. This was the first time on my trip I didn’t tip. I cannot believe we paid for that torture. Highly DO NOT recommend!

YVRunners –
This park is amazing and the ads don’t do it justice. There are so many areas to explore – cultural, ecological, adventure on and off land. I gave this review a 5/5. But it should really be a 4.5/5. I’ll explain below the few cons:
Upon arrival, we pre-booked a few things. One of which was the dinner during the show. 2 adults and two children ages 5 and 3. Adults are full price, children 5 and older are half price and children under 5 are free! Great!! However once seated at dinner, our 3 year old wasn’t served any food or drinks. So free means your kid doesn’t eat which is absurd. We were served our food and he was just looking at us wondering why he was forgotten. So we had to pay extra so he can have food.
Another small issue was the river entrance. There are so many at the beginning, with very little direction as to which one offers which experience. Once at the end of the river, we realized that other pathways went through bat caves. We would have like to know which one.
Lastly, the children’s area was an adventure style obstacle course with two water slides. Adults have to watch from the sidelines coaching along the way. It would have been nice to join the kids.
The staff everywhere are amazing the park is clean and well run. A beautiful gift shop. Delicious food. Very well organized and well laid out. We will go back again as with two small kids we weren’t able to see or enjoy all the things xcaret has to offer. It’s definitely a good idea to spend two days there if you can afford and have the time. It’s wonderful.
And the show!!! Spectacular! Hint: Pay attention during the finale!
